Book Fair

 

 Walk like an Egyptian....straight to the Sloan Book Fair! From September 16 through September 20, 2013, during their regularly scheduled library time and during Open House on Sept. 16th and/or 17th, Sloan students will take an exotic journey to Ancient Egypt, where they will have the opportunity to discover (and purchase) literary treasures at every turn!  

 

If you are sending money, remember that all items are subject to 6% sales tax, so please include this in your check or payment. Please make checks payable to "Sloan PTO" and include your phone number. Change will be given for checks made out in excess of the amount of purchase.

 

Profits made at the Book Fair benefit the PTO, as well as our school and classroom libraries, by allowing us to add the newest and finest titles to our collections. Plus, the Book Fair gives you a rewarding and memorable opportunity to be involved in our school and with our children. The Book Fair is an exciting and wonderful way to help children associate reading and books with fun, instead of just homework.

Wear a Hat for Cancer       
 

 This day-long event will raise vital funds to help benefit children being treated for cancer.   Students may make a $2 minimum donation in exchange for wearing a hat to school on Friday, September 20th. All donations will directly support the needs of the Division of Hematology/Oncology at Children's Hospital of Pittsburgh. It is a fun day for the students and teachers at Sloan, while supporting a wonderful cause.
